Punjab Government is famous for its infrastructure development. One may find a network of Roads, bridges and flyovers across Punjab during PML-N rule. After Metro in Punjab’s Metropolitan cities now PM has announced Motorway from Lahore to Karachi. Now Punjab Chief Minister has announced another program name “Khadim-e-Punjab Rural roads Programme” for the construction and rehabilitation of roads in rural areas of the province. Under the phased wise programme, a total of Rs 150 billion would be spent on roads construction and rehabilitation over a period of three years.
It is a good step because it will connect the huge population that lacks basic infrastructure. With connecting to other cities, it also helps such villages and rural areas to have improved economic activities, better access to education in nearby cities and better health facilities in suburbs areas.
